

|  | THE CLIMB
The true, gripping, and thought-provoking
account of the worst disaster in the history of
Mount Everest.
On May 10, 1996, two commercial
expeditions headed by experienced leaders attempted
to climb the highest mountain in the world. Crowded
conditions on the mountain, miscommunications,
unexplainable delays, poor leadership, bad decisions,
and a blinding storm conspired to kill.
Anatoli
Boukreev shares what transpired
that day on the peak, in a dramatic first-person
account.
